Output 50d4d6f6877818558c60952319130e53c3dfc06037873bc172307b6683bc53b5:189

value
369321
script pubkey
OP_0 OP_PUSHBYTES_32 03eecf21fc4463b014d69266d170ce3ad484a270a8b6e35157b423a99981caaf
address
bc1qq0hv7g0ug33mq9xkjfndzuxw8t2gfgns4zmwx52hks36nxvpe2hsl3jwyc
transaction
50d4d6f6877818558c60952319130e53c3dfc06037873bc172307b6683bc53b5
spent
true